Parsippany Student Earns Dean's List Honors at Muhlenberg College

Dana Punskovsky recognized for academic excellence at selective liberal arts institution.

Published on Feb. 21, 2026

Dana Punskovsky, a graduate of Parsippany High School, has been named to the Fall 2025 Dean's List at Muhlenberg College in Allentown, Pennsylvania. Punskovsky is currently studying Media and Communication at the highly selective liberal arts college, where students must earn a grade point average of 3.5 or higher to qualify for the prestigious academic honor.

The details

To earn a spot on the Dean's List, Punskovsky completed at least three course units during the semester while maintaining a GPA of 3.5 or higher. Muhlenberg College is a four-year residential institution that enrolls nearly 2,000 bachelor's and master's degree-seeking students, known for its strong academic programs and close faculty mentorship.
